I remember seeing this in other posts but I wasn't concerned then. My situation is as follows: I have 5 Japanese CVs with about 10 AM6V2 zeroes each (not enough) in September '43, I have 0 AM6V3a zeroes in the pool and somehow this model is the only one my carrier AM6V2s upgrade to. The production is all set to AM6V5 zekes by this time. So what do I try to do? Switch a few factories to produce AM6V3a's so that I can at least upgrade to something (what I could also try is producing AM6V2s as replacements).But guess what happens? The factories switched to AM6V3a get switched back to zekes on the next turn[&:]. Do I have to try the replacement option, or just wait and watch my carriers fight with no CAP at all?

Turn automatic upgrade on for these air units and stick them in port, they should skip the a6m3 step and go directly to a6m5's assuming you have a6m5's available.
